Clinton Praises SA for 16 Years of Freedom

Thousands across the country on Tuesday marked the country's first democratic elections by celebrating Freedom Day.

"On behalf of President Obama and the American people, I congratulate the people of the Republic of South Africa as you celebrate the sixteenth anniversary of your democracy.

"The April 27, 1994 elections were the culmination of decades of struggle and opened a new era of equality and opportunity in South Africa," said Clinton.

She said South Africa's story serves as an inspiration to people around the world who are yearning to be free.

"Your progress is a testament to the resilience of the human spirit and the transformative power of democracy," she said.

Clinton said the partnership between South Africa and the US is rooted in shared values and common aspirations.

"Our two countries share the goal of ridding the world of discrimination in all its forms, promoting broad-based prosperity and opportunity, and supporting democracy and the rule of law," she said.

Clinton added that the two countries had much to learn from one another and that there is a lot to accomplish together.

"The US-South Africa Strategic Dialogue that we launched last month provides a framework for meeting our common challenges," she said.
